Carol perceived a neigh of releif when the horse was unhitched from the heavy sleigh. Which underlined word is misspelled? A. sl

eigh B. perceived C. neigh D. releif
English
2 answers:
Jlenok [28]4 years ago
5 0
D releif its really spelled relief
telo118 [61]4 years ago
4 0

The correct answer is D. Releif

Explanation:

The word spelling refers to the letters that compose a word and the order these should have to be considered as correct. Because of this, when words are misspelled is because the letters in a word are not in the correct order, letters that are not correct have been added or letters have been omitted, which is a common mistake in writing. In the case of the sentence "Carol perceived a neigh of releif when the horse was unhitched from the heavy sleigh", the word whose letters are not in the correct order and therefore is a misspelled word or shows a mistake in spelling is "releif", because the correct word is written "relief" and means an alleviation feeling, while the word "releif" does not exist in English language.

A SUMMER'S READING
S_A_V [24]

In a Summer´s Reading by Bernard Malamud,George's daydreams tell us about him  that  he shares the expectaions of the American Dream.

He wants to be well-off , to get a job that would allow him to buy a house with porch in a green suburban area. This money would gain him people´s respect.

George avoids Mr.Cattanzara by crossing the street when he approaches Mr Cattanzara´s house. He feels despair because he is unable to keep his promise to read 100 books.

"George knew he looks passable on the outside, but he was crumbling apart." He feel this way because he has managed to earn people´s respect by making them believe he can read such a large number of books; however, he knows his lie is short-lived and will soon be discovered.
